Portable battery-powered instruments Digital gain and offset adjustment Programmable voltage and current sources Programmable attenuators GENERAL DESCRIPTION The AD5601/AD5611/AD5621, members of the nanoDAC® family, are single, 8-/10-/12-bit, buffered voltage output DACs that operate from a single 2.7 V to 5.5 V supply, consuming typically 75 µA at 5 V . The parts come in tiny LFCSP and SC70 packages. Their on-chip precision output amplifier allows rail- to-rail output swing to be achieved. The AD5601/AD5611/ AD5621 utilize a versatile 3-wire serial interface that operates at clock rates up to 30 MHz and is compatible with SPI, QSPI™, MICROWIRE™, and DSP interface standards. The reference for the AD5601/AD5611/AD5621 is derived from the power supply inputs and, therefore, gives the widest dynamic output range. The parts incorporate a power-on reset circuit, which ensures that the DAC output powers up to 0 V and remains there until a valid write to the device takes place. The AD5601/AD5611/AD5621 contain a power-down feature that reduces current consumption to typically 0.2 µA at 3 V. FUNCTIONAL BLOCK DIAGRAM Figure 1. Table 1. F | Page 18 of 24 CHOOSING A REFERENCE AS POWER SUPPLY FOR THE AD5601/AD5611/AD5621 The AD5601/AD5611/AD5621 come in tiny LFCSP and SC70 packages with less than a 100 µA supply current. Because of this, the choice of reference depends on the application requirements. For applications with space-saving requirements, the ADR02 is recommended. It is available in an SC70 package and has excellent drift at 9 ppm/°C (3 ppm/°C in the R-8 package) and provides very good noise performance at 3.4 µV p-p in the 0.1 Hz to 10 Hz range. Because the supply current required by the AD5601/AD5611/ AD5621 is extremely low, the parts are ideal for low supply applications. The ADR395 voltage reference is recommended in this case. It requires less than 100 µA of quiescent current and can, therefore, drive multiple DACs in one system, if required. It also provides very good noise performance at 8 µV p-p in the 0.1 Hz to 10 Hz range. Figure 51. ADR395 as Power Supply to the AD5601/AD5611/AD5621 the AD5601/AD5611/AD5621 are listed in Table 7.
